Merge the two, similar sounding messaging services into one. It's confusing having two similar services.

Description

Merge the two, similar sounding messaging services into one. This will put the bullhorn, event bus style, messaging, and the email stuff in one place.

Attachments

1
  • 30 Mar 2023, 11:14 PM

Activity

Andrea Schmidt March 30, 2023 at 11:14 PM

24x: https://trunk-maria.nightly.sakaiproject.org/, build:ea4d73ac
23x: https://qa23-maria.nightly.sakaiproject.org/, build: 061e1639
The student sees the bullhorn notification after the instructor posted the assignment, once the student submits an email for the submission is received.

No notification in bullhorns for the submission - believe this is correct from previous behavior.
There is another notification in bullhorns when the instructor grades and releases the assignment.

However, there is an issue with the bullhorn notifications on 23 & 24. See the screen shot. Since this was already merged, I created a Jira.

23 & 24 only have the assignment name: https://sakaiproject.atlassian.net/browse/SAK-48709

Andrea Schmidt March 29, 2023 at 10:08 PM

Do you want the test plan updated to check for an email upon submitting an assignment instead? Is there any other tool that needs to also be checked at the same tie to make sure everything is working as expected?

Adam Marshall March 25, 2023 at 8:38 PM

I checked sakai 20 and setting up an assignment doesnt trigger an email to Joe Student. That’s pretty conclusive in my book.

Andrea Schmidt March 24, 2023 at 10:36 PM

Just checked mailinator - had a student submit an assignment on 23x for another Jira, and those emails do arrive.

Adrian Fish March 24, 2023 at 9:56 PM
Edited

I don’t think I was right about new assignments triggering an email. I don’t think they do, but I’ll check in the morning. I think you get an email when you submit as a student.

Fixed

Details

Priority

Affects versions

23 Status

QA Verification Pass

Components

Assignee

Reporter

Conversion Script Required

Yes

Created December 8, 2022 at 11:33 AM
Updated March 30, 2023 at 11:15 PM
Resolved December 14, 2022 at 4:41 PM

Flag notifications